The pattern details are:-

Spun Out #4 – 1982

Child’s Fair Isle Yoke Sweater
(Originially published in 1974 as Elizabeth’s Wool Gathering #11)

By Elizabeth Zimmermann and Meg Swanson

It is the customers pattern and she supplied the yarn which was Jamieson & Smith 2ply Jumper Yarn, 100% Pure New Wool, from Shetland.

The jumper was knitted on circular needles from the bottom up.  There is a hem at the bottom.  This was the first time I had seen an Elizabeth Zimmermann pattern and it was a bit different from the patterns that I normally use, but I got there in the end, I think!

The yarn knitted up a bit uneven, but it looks ok now that it is all finished.
